Unfortunately, regardless of having a huge variety of members, Passion.com does not currently have a mobile app out there out there. Although you can still access this dating website through your cell phone’s browser, it is nonetheless a huge disadvantage particularly for a website that encourages informal flings and instant digital and personal hookups. For on-the-go users, they would have to painstakingly load the positioning on their mobile phones every time they need a quick replace. This is not solely inconvenient but also can drive different customers to search for different hookup apps which have a cellular app version. The Gold membership prices $31 per month, but it can save you cash by selecting a long term membership plan. Understandably, Passion.com works on a membership foundation, however we had been definitely dissatisfied to see that users are left with no choice but to buy the membership. As a standard user, all you can do is create an account and browse the galleries. The rest of the options are only out there to paying members.

Still, as quickly as we created our profile, we were just about attacked with messages from customers who didn’t appear actual in any respect. We tend to believe that those messages are only there to make you pay for the membership, which is why we don’t consider Passion.com to be a particularly protected web site.
